Update utf8 task
This commit is contained in:
parent
84d9f411c5
commit
201caf1971
1 changed files with 2 additions and 3 deletions
|
@ -12,9 +12,8 @@
|
||||||
Данный эффект связан с тем, что в юникоде некоторые руны умеют комбинироваться в одну графему.
|
Данный эффект связан с тем, что в юникоде некоторые руны умеют комбинироваться в одну графему.
|
||||||
|
|
||||||
Ваша реализация должна быть достаточно эффективна. На нашем бенчмарке в тестовой системе
|
Ваша реализация должна быть достаточно эффективна. На нашем бенчмарке в тестовой системе
|
||||||
она должна работать не хуже авторского решения. В частности, код должен делать не больше двух
|
она должна работать не хуже авторского решения. Конкретно, можно делать не больше одной аллокации.
|
||||||
аллокаций. Эту функцию можно написать с одной аллокацией, но придётся использовать пакет unsafe.
|
Это значит, что кроме выходной строки дополнительную память выделять нельзя.
|
||||||
Работу с unsafe мы будем разбирать дальше в курсе.
|
|
||||||
|
|
||||||
```
|
```
|
||||||
goos: linux
|
goos: linux
|
||||||
|
|
Loading…
Reference in a new issue